Boeing Company Charitable Trust
The Boeing Company Charitable Trust is a private foundation established in 1964 in Washington as the successor to the Boeing Airplane Company Charitable Trust, which was founded in 1952. Based in Chicago, Illinois, the trust operates as a company-sponsored foundation supporting a broad range of charitable initiatives across the United States.

Under IRS private-foundation payout rules, Boeing Company Charitable Trust reported a distributable amount of $4.8M for 2024 — the minimum it must pay out in qualifying distributions.

Financial History
Multi-year comparison from IRS filings
Assets & Revenue (Most Recent Filing - 2024):
- Total assets: $104,805,075
- Total revenues: $24,583,640
- Investment income and dividends: $3,673,231
- Total expenses: $4,934,105
- Total giving: $4,400,000
Previous Year (2023):
- Total assets: $85,200,000
- Total revenues: $1,660,000
- Total expenses: $3,650,000
The foundation has no liabilities and derives income primarily from investments.
| Metric |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Assets | $104,805,075 | $85,167,955 | $86,233,869 |
| Revenue | $24,583,640 | $1,661,977 | $1,892,559 |
| Expenses | $4,934,105 | $3,646,697 | $5,781,242 |
| Qualifying Distributions | $4,619,553 | $3,390,747 | $5,446,692 |
| Net Investment Income | $24,332,135 | $3,009,176 | $2,691,423 |
| Distributable Amount | $4,781,483 | $4,572,600 | $4,643,004 |

Among its reported 2024 grants, the largest include The Blackbaud Giving Fund ($1,500,000), American National Red Cross ($1,025,000), Florida Disaster Fund ($500,000).
| Recipient | Purpose | Amount |
|---|---|---|
| AMERICAN NATIONAL RED CROSS WASHINGTON, DC | GENERAL SUPPORT | $1,025,000 |
| BRAZIL FOUNDATION NEW YORK, NY | GENERAL SUPPORT | $200,000 |
| CARE ATLANTA, GA | GENERAL SUPPORT | $100,000 |
| THE BLACKBAUD GIVING FUND CHARLESTON, SC | GENERAL SUPPORT | $1,500,000 |
| COMBINED ARMS Houston, TX | GENERAL SUPPORT | $75,000 |
| LOWCOUNTRY FOOD BANK NORTH CHARLESTON, SC | GENERAL SUPPORT | $100,000 |
| NORTH CAROLINA COMMUNITY FOUNDATION RALEIGH, NC | GENERAL SUPPORT | $250,000 |
| NORTHSHORE COMMUNITY FOUNDATION COVINGTON, LA | GENERAL SUPPORT | $100,000 |
| PRECINT2GETHER INC WEBSTER, TX | GENERAL SUPPORT | $50,000 |
| HOUSTON FOOD BANK HOUSTON, TX | GENERAL SUPPORT | $75,000 |

How much is Boeing Company Charitable Trust required to give away each year?
Private foundations must generally distribute about 5% of their assets annually. For 2024, Boeing Company Charitable Trust reported a distributable amount of $4.8M on its IRS Form 990-PF — the minimum it must pay out in qualifying distributions.
